ZANU PF Youth 'Very Happy' With Fuel Price Hike

Zanu PF deputy youth secretary Lewis Mathuthu said his party was very happy with the recently announced fuel price hike. President Mnangagwa on Saturday night sent the nation into deep sorrow when he announced that fuel prices will go up by 150 per cent.

Mathuthu said that the move is a positive one since local fuel was being smuggled to neighbouring countries such as Mozambique. Said Mathuthu:

I am very happy that the price of fuel has finally been pegged up to standard in terms of what other countries are doing. A lot of fuel was going out of the country. A lot of our fuel was going to Mozambique, South Africa and DRC.

… We do not expect the prices of other commodities to go up because they are already exorbitant and it was only fuel that was very low and the government was carrying the burden of subsidising fuel using foreign currency, something that we don’t have.
